NHS LOTHIAN

LOCUM APPOINTMENT FOR SERVICE IN GASTROENTEROLOGY
ROYAL INFIRMARY OF EDINBURGH & WESTERN GENERAL HOSPITAL


Reference: 172492

NHS Lothian is committed to encouraging equality and diversity among our workforce, and eliminating unlawful discrimination.

The aim is for our workforce to be truly representative and for each employee to feel respected and able to give their best.


Applications are welcome for the above fixed term, full time 40 hours per week post based in the Royal Infirmary of Edinburgh or Western General Hospital.


Applications are invited for the posts of Advanced Clinical Fellow in Gastroenterology at Western General Hospital (WGH), Edinburgh and Royal Infirmary of Edinburgh (RIE).

These posts will run for one year from August 2024.


These are one year advanced clinical fellowship posts for gastroenterology trainees who have completed their basic gastroenterology training and are independently competent in routine upper and lower gastrointestinal endoscopy (including endotherapy for acute upper GI bleeding and level 2 polypectomy) as well as clinical work, and who wish to obtain advanced training in specialised clinical and/or endoscopic areas such as advanced endoscopic techniques.

Both hospital sites have a strong track record in advanced training.

The advanced Clinical Fellow post at RIE will spend around 50% of their job plan on service commitment (e.g. clinics, diagnostic endoscopy) and the remaining time is focused around training in hepatobiliary endoscopy (ERCP/EUS).

The advanced Clinical Fellow post at WGH will spend around 50% of their job plan on service commitment (e.g. clinics, diagnostic endoscopy) and the remaining time is spent offering specialist training, audit and research in inflammatory bowel disease and in advanced colonoscopy.

Both posts will participate on the Gastroenterology out of hours on-call rota.

These posts do not have educational approval from the Postgraduate Dean and will not be recognised for training.
